LinuxParty
El éxito empresarial es el resultado de un conjunto de factores, pero uno de los elementos esenciales y a menudo subestimado es el diseño centrado en el usuario. En la era digital, donde la experiencia del cliente es un factor diferenciador clave, el diseño centrado en el usuario se posiciona como un pilar fundamental para el crecimiento y la sostenibilidad de cualquier empresa.
En el tejido empresarial actual, donde la competencia es feroz y la atención del cliente es fugaz, la prioridad de satisfacer y deleitar a los usuarios se ha vuelto más imperativa que nunca. El diseño centrado en el usuario no solo se trata de la estética visual, sino de comprender las necesidades, deseos y comportamientos de los usuarios, y luego utilizar este entendimiento para moldear productos, servicios y experiencias que sean intuitivos, atractivos y funcionales.
Linux se está volviendo popular rápidamente, especialmente con el uso cada vez menor de Windows (me corregirán si eso no es cierto) y para promover Linux y luchar por lograr el uso deseado de Linux en el escritorio, los programadores y desarrolladores de software de Linux están poniendo más esfuerzo y trabajo duro en el desarrollo de aplicaciones de escritorio que coincidan con las aplicaciones de escritorio de Windows y Mac OS X.
Esto es cierto, especialmente con innumerables distribuciones de Linux que se centran en facilitar que los nuevos usuarios de Linux (que anteriormente usaban Windows o Mac OS X) se adapten fácilmente al sistema operativo.
Hay muchos lenguajes de programación y de vez en cuando surgen otros nuevos, pero como futuro desarrollador de software Linux centrado en aplicaciones de escritorio, es necesario comprender lo que se necesita para crear sistemas confiables, eficientes, flexibles, extensibles, fáciles de usar y sobre todo aplicaciones seguras. Y una de las primeras cosas que uno debe saber es entender el lenguaje apropiado para los diferentes desarrollos de software.
El enigmático sonido que presuntamente emana de un agujero negro ha generado controversia y debate en las redes sociales.
El revelador audio ha provocado opiniones divididas. Algunos sostienen que representa el sonido del purgatorio, mientras que otros lo rechazan, argumentando que es simplemente una representación sonora. Si ése es el lugar donde ni se escapa la luz... Sería la mejor de las cárceles para las almas...
Describir el sonido del clip resulta complicado, pero se asemeja a lamentos acompañados de un eco profundo. En cualquier caso, el sonido es genuinamente inquietante.
Nextcloud amplía su catálogo de soluciones de productividad al integrar el experimentado cliente de correo electrónico Roundcube. Aunque se describe como una fusión, en realidad es una adopción, ya que Roundcube se incorpora a los proyectos de Nextcloud, manteniendo su versatilidad. Esta asociación responde a los desafíos planteados por la centralización tecnológica, beneficiando tanto al sector público como al privado y a los usuarios domésticos.
Nextcloud, conocida por ser una suite de aplicaciones de productividad en la nube de código abierto, ofrece alternativas a servicios privativos como los de Google o Microsoft. Con funciones que abarcan desde almacenamiento y sincronización de archivos hasta contactos, calendarios, tareas y videoconferencias.
Mientras la propuesta de la jornada laboral de cuatro días está en boca de todos, el magnate y filántropo Bill Gates plantea una idea diferente que involucra la inteligencia artificial. En una reciente aparición en el podcast "What Now?" de Trevor Noah, Gates sugiere que "la tecnología no reemplazará a los humanos, pero podría hacer posible una semana laboral de tres días".
Gates, conocido por compartir sus reflexiones sobre el futuro de la humanidad y la tecnología en su blog, abordó el tema de una jornada laboral más corta durante el podcast. Imagina un mundo en el que la inteligencia artificial desempeñe un papel crucial, siendo un factor clave para lograr una semana laboral de tres días.
Muchos usuarios de Plex se alarmaron cuando recibieron un correo electrónico de "revisión de la semana" la semana pasada que les mostraba lo que ellos y sus amigos habían visto en el popular software de servidor de medios. De un informe:
Algunos usuarios dicen que los hábitos de pornografía suave de sus amigos se les revelan con la función, mientras que otros están horrorizados por la característica de naturaleza potencialmente invasiva en general. Plex es un servicio de transmisión híbrido/servidor de medios autohospedado.
Un sistema láser ya en servicio, el Iron Bean de la israelí Rafael (Ministerio de Defensa de Israel)
La empresa conjunta de Indra Sistemas y Escribano Mechanical & Engineering ha sido seleccionada para desarrollar un sistema láser antiaéreo denominado "Demostrador Instrumental de Arma Láser" (DIAL), como parte de un contrato valorado en 10,9 millones de euros.
Este proyecto está bajo la supervisión de la Subdirección General de Adquisiciones de Armamento y Material (DGAM), y la propuesta de la Unión Temporal de Empresas (UTE) conformada por ambas compañías fue la única presentada y ahora tiene un plazo de ejecución hasta el 31 de diciembre de 2027. En la evaluación de ofertas, se asignó un peso significativo del 75 % a la valoración técnica.
Esta versión también presenta la depuración y la creación de perfiles para CMake 3.27 y versiones posteriores, así como varias mejoras.
El Proyecto Qt anunció hoy el lanzamiento y la disponibilidad general de Qt Creator 12 como la última actualización estable para esta aplicación de entorno de desarrollo integrado (IDE) multiplataforma, gratuita y de código abierto.
Qt Creator es un entorno de desarrollo integrado (IDE, por sus siglas en inglés) diseñado para facilitar el desarrollo de aplicaciones utilizando el framework Qt. Qt es un conjunto de herramientas y bibliotecas de desarrollo de software que proporciona funcionalidades para la creación de interfaces gráficas de usuario (GUI), así como para el manejo de eventos, comunicación en red, manejo de archivos, y más. Es especialmente conocido por su enfoque en ser multiplataforma, lo que significa que las aplicaciones desarrolladas con Qt pueden ejecutarse en varios sistemas operativos, como Windows, Linux y macOS, sin necesidad de realizar cambios significativos en el código fuente.
Qt Creator se integra estrechamente con las capacidades y características de Qt, lo que facilita a los desarrolladores escribir, depurar y compilar código para aplicaciones Qt. Algunas de las características notables de Qt Creator incluyen:
-
Editor de C++: Qt Creator incluye un editor de código fuente para el lenguaje de programación C++, que es comúnmente utilizado en el desarrollo de aplicaciones Qt.
-
Depuración: Proporciona herramientas avanzadas de depuración para ayudar a los desarrolladores a identificar y corregir errores en sus programas.
-
Diseñador de Interfaces Gráficas: Facilita la creación de interfaces gráficas mediante un diseñador visual que permite arrastrar y soltar elementos para construir la interfaz de usuario.
-
Administrador de Proyectos: Permite organizar y gestionar proyectos de desarrollo de software de manera eficiente.
-
Integración con Qt: Está diseñado para trabajar de manera integrada con las bibliotecas y herramientas de Qt, simplificando el proceso de desarrollo.
-
Soporte Multiplataforma: Qt Creator es compatible con el desarrollo multiplataforma, permitiendo a los desarrolladores crear aplicaciones que pueden ejecutarse en diferentes sistemas operativos con relativa facilidad.
En resumen, Qt Creator es una herramienta poderosa para el desarrollo de aplicaciones basadas en el framework Qt, ofreciendo un entorno de desarrollo eficiente y funcionalidades que facilitan la creación de software multiplataforma con interfaces gráficas de usuario.
Qt Creator 12 está aquí cuatro meses después de Qt Creator 11 e introduce varias características nuevas, comenzando con la integración del Compiler Explorer creado por Matt Godbolt. Con esto, Qt Creator le pedirá al Compiler Explorer que compile y ejecute el código, genere un ensamblado y le muestre el resultado.
Perfeccionar tus habilidades en codificación es esencial, y los sitios web especializados en problemas de codificación son aliados cruciales en este viaje de aprendizaje y crecimiento. Estos recursos, que van desde desafíos individuales hasta evaluaciones detalladas, ofrecen una plataforma conveniente y gratuita para abordar los aspectos fundamentales de la programación, ya seas un principiante o un desarrollador en busca de mejorar.
Descubre los Mejores Sitios Web para Potenciar tus Habilidades en Codificación
Comenzar desde cero en la programación puede ser desafiante, pero la práctica constante es clave. Presentamos una lista alfabética de 10 sitios web destacados que ofrecen problemas de codificación y recursos para ampliar tus conocimientos: